91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

MySQL Connector如何處理大量的并發請求

小樊
88
2024-09-02 18:57:49
欄目: 云計算

MySQL Connector 是一個用于連接 MySQL 數據庫的庫,它可以處理大量的并發請求。為了確保 MySQL Connector 能夠高效地處理大量的并發請求,可以采取以下策略:

  1. 使用連接池:連接池可以幫助你重用已經建立的數據庫連接,而不是為每個請求創建新的連接。這樣可以減少連接建立和關閉的開銷,提高性能。在 Python 中,可以使用 mysql-connector-python 庫的 pooling 模塊來實現連接池。

  2. 限制并發連接數:根據服務器的資源情況,合理設置 MySQL 數據庫的最大連接數。這可以防止服務器資源耗盡,確保系統的穩定性。

  3. 優化查詢:避免使用復雜的查詢語句,盡量使用索引。對于大量數據的操作,可以考慮分批處理,避免一次性加載過多數據。

  4. 使用緩存:對于頻繁訪問的數據,可以使用緩存(如 Redis)來存儲數據,減少對數據庫的訪問。

  5. 數據庫分區:對于大量數據的表,可以考慮使用分區技術,將數據分散到多個物理文件中,提高查詢性能。

  6. 數據庫讀寫分離:通過將讀操作和寫操作分離到不同的數據庫服務器上,可以提高系統的并發處理能力。

  7. 使用異步編程:在編寫應用程序時,可以使用異步編程模型(如 Python 的 asyncio)來處理并發請求,提高系統的吞吐量。

  8. 監控和調優:定期監控數據庫的性能指標,如連接數、查詢時間等,根據實際情況進行調優。

通過以上策略,可以幫助 MySQL Connector 更好地處理大量的并發請求,提高系統的性能和穩定性。

0
陆川县| 庄浪县| 安新县| 塔城市| 白朗县| 佛学| 宁陕县| 沙田区| 定结县| 鹤壁市| 三门峡市| 石柱| 衡南县| 安平县| 漯河市| 两当县| 繁峙县| 沂南县| 黔江区| 浪卡子县| 恭城| 沈阳市| 新乡市| 沅江市| 烟台市| 佛山市| 肇庆市| 德钦县| 改则县| 雷州市| 龙口市| 崇礼县| 专栏| 永靖县| 衡阳市| 象山县| 凌源市| 华宁县| 厦门市| 富源县| 金寨县|